Well, frankly…I think that Creatine and good old fashioned protein are the best thing…..they’ve worked in the past - and will work now and in the future.
Creatine is found in red meat and such……so it’s natural. And of course, we all need protein.
In order to build muscle, keep in mind that one must consume at least one gram of protein per pound of weight that they weigh. Case in point, I weigh 195lbs…so I should take in 195 grams of protein to build….I don’t always consume that much in a day - but I try.
Anyway,…..creatine and protein buddy. For me - that’s the ticket

Creatine and whey protein are probably the best basic supplements to help build muscle. As well as a multivitamin. These will work to there full potential when your diet and training program have been perfected.
There are others like ZMA and GABA which also work and promote natural hormone production and are completely natural. These are a little more advanced. There are also legal prohormones, but I wouldn’t recommend these unless you really know what you are doing.
I always recommend perfecting your diet and training before going to supplements.
Also, supplements such as creatine and whey protein as well as most others have no negative side effects.
